Catalog description

This course focuses on the phenomena of leisure, recreation and play and their impact on individuals and society. It traces the historical development of recreation and leisure and the corresponding concepts of time, work, meaning, pleasure, culture, technology, and rapid change. Students are challenged to think critically about the issues related to choices an individual and society make when using "free time" and the resulting benefits and consequences.
